# Unified Review — Generic Checklist
|
|
|
|
Reference for the Layer-1 chain decomposition and gstack CRITICAL sub-pass.
|
|
Load the language-specific checklist when available (`java-spring.md`,
|
|
`python-django.md`, `python-fastapi.md`, `node-express.md`, `go-gin.md`,
|
|
`csharp-dotnet.md`, `rust.md`, `php-laravel.md`, `ruby-rails.md`); otherwise
|
|
use this generic list.
|
|
|
|
## Layer 1 — eight categories
|
|
|
|
For each changed area mark ✅ Clean / ⚠️ Issues Found / — N/A.
|
|
|
|
1. **Interface** — parameter validation, response conventions, HTTP status
|
|
codes, rate limiting, API versioning, protocol correctness
|
|
2. **Business** — logic aligns with requirements, state machine correctness,
|
|
idempotency design, distributed locks
|
|
3. **Data** — SQL injection, query performance, index usage, transaction
|
|
boundaries, cache invalidation
|
|
4. **Utility** — input validity, no side effects, error return values,
|
|
date/time timezone handling
|
|
5. **Error handling** — exception classification, fallback logic, error
|
|
message sanitization, retry with backoff
|
|
6. **Security** — AuthN/AuthZ, sensitive data masking, permission control,
|
|
CSRF/XSS prevention
|
|
7. **Performance** — N+1 queries, caching strategy, connection pooling,
|
|
batch operations, blocking in async paths
|
|
8. **Observability** — structured logging with correlation IDs, metrics,
|
|
health checks

## gstack CRITICAL sub-pass (highest severity)
|
|
|
|
### SQL & Data Safety
|
|
- String interpolation in SQL — use parameterized queries
|
|
- TOCTOU check-then-set — use atomic `WHERE` + update
|
|
- Bypassing model validations for direct DB writes
|
|
- N+1 queries — missing eager loading
|
|
|
|
### Race Conditions & Concurrency
|
|
- Read-check-write without uniqueness constraint / duplicate-key retry
|
|
- find-or-create without a unique DB index
|
|
- Status transitions not atomic (`WHERE old_status = ? UPDATE ...`)
|
|
- Unsafe HTML rendering on user-controlled data
|
|
|
|
### LLM Output Trust Boundary
|
|
- LLM-generated values (emails, URLs, names) written to DB without format
|
|
validation
|
|
- Structured tool output accepted without type/shape checks
|
|
- LLM-generated URLs fetched without an allowlist (SSRF)
|
|
- LLM output stored in knowledge bases without sanitization (stored prompt
|
|
injection)
|
|
|
|
### Shell Injection
|
|
- `subprocess` with `shell=True` AND interpolated command strings
|
|
- `os.system()` with variable interpolation
|
|
- `eval()`/`exec()` on LLM-generated code without sandboxing
|
|
|
|
### Enum & Value Completeness
|
|
- New enum/status/tier values: read (not just grep) every consumer that
|
|
switches/filters/displays the value
|
|
- Check allowlists and `case`/`if-elsif` chains for fall-through

## Suppressions — do NOT flag
|
|
- Harmless redundancy that aids readability
|
|
- "Add a comment explaining a threshold" — thresholds drift
|
|
- Consistency-only changes
|
|
- Anything already addressed in the diff
|
|
|
|
## Severity
|
|
- 🔴 **blocker** — must fix before merge (injection, secrets, missing
|
|
transaction, auth bypass) → verdict FAIL
|
|
- 🟡 **major** — should fix before merge (missing validation, missing
|
|
fallback, N+1, unmasked data)
|
|
- 🔵 **minor** — can optimize later (naming, duplicate code, comments)
|
|
|
|
## Confidence calibration
|
|
- 9-10 verified by reading specific code
|
|
- 7-8 high-confidence pattern match
|
|
- 5-6 medium — show with caveat
|
|
- 3-4 low — move to appendix
|
|
- 1-2 speculation — suppress unless severity would be P0
|
|
|
|
Every finding: `[SEVERITY] (confidence: N/10) file:line — problem → fix`.
